About Brian Shank

Brian Shank, 59, current County Council Chairman, is all about service.

Brian is a graduate of Harbor Creek High School, Class of 1981. He enlisted in the US Army in 1983 and was honorably discharged in 1987. He also attended The Contra Costa Community College Basic Police Academy.

In terms of service to his country, Brian said, "I served on active duty in the U.S. Army from 1983 to 1987. My first MOS/job was photographer. I then enlisted into the California Army National Guard as a 95 B military police officer."

Regarding service to his community, Brian has been serving on the council for over three years, and this is his second consecutive year as Chair. He is a conservative, fiscal steward of hard-earned tax dollars.

Moreover, Brian is also committed to serving his fellow citizens. He volunteers as a fire police officer with the Fairfield Hose Company and assembles wheelchair ramps for disabled veterans.
